Transaction 102804bab80c2a5574d2cbfbd481b7a9ab5c41b21f71e6dacba50c7ea1865756
1 Input
1 Output
-
102804bab80c2a5574d2cbfbd481b7a9ab5c41b21f71e6dacba50c7ea1865756:0
- value
- 1331434
- script pubkey
- OP_0 OP_PUSHBYTES_20 7235621f53682596ddb1c4aef4b220ba59c58602
- address
- bc1qwg6ky86ndqjedhd3cjh0fv3qhfvutpszmf4vza